Indian Navy Agniveer SSR Recruitment 2026 – Apply Online for 01/2027 & 02/2027 Batch
🏢 Department / Organization Description
The Indian Navy (Directorate of Manpower Planning & Recruitment, Naval Headquarters, New Delhi) has released an official recruitment notification inviting online applications from unmarried male and unmarried female candidates for enrolment as Agniveer (SSR) for the 01/2027 and 02/2027 batches. This recruitment is conducted under the Agnipath Scheme introduced by the Government of India. Selected candidates will serve in the Indian Navy for a period of four years and will form a distinct rank known as Agniveer, which is the junior-most rank in the Navy. During the service period, candidates will receive professional training, allowances, and benefits as per Navy rules. After completion of four years, up to 25% of candidates may be selected for permanent enrolment based on performance, while others will receive a financial package called Seva Nidhi.

💰 Vacancy-wise Salary Breakup
The salary structure for Agniveer is designed under the Agnipath scheme with yearly increments and contribution to corpus fund.
- 1st Year: ₹30,000 (In-hand ₹21,000 + ₹9,000 corpus)
- 2nd Year: ₹33,000 (In-hand ₹23,100 + ₹9,900 corpus)
- 3rd Year: ₹36,500 (In-hand ₹25,550 + ₹10,950 corpus)
- 4th Year: ₹40,000 (In-hand ₹28,000 + ₹12,000 corpus)
- Total Seva Nidhi: ₹10.04 Lakhs (approx including govt contribution)

🎓 Eligibility Criteria (Post-wise)
Educational Qualification for SSR Agniveer:
>10+2 with Mathematics & Physics and minimum 50% aggregate marks from recognized board.
>OR 3 years Diploma in Engineering (Mechanical/Electrical/Computer/IT etc.) with 50% marks.
>OR 2 years Vocational Course with Physics & Mathematics with 50% marks.
>Candidates appearing in 12th exam are also eligible (must produce marksheet later).

📝 Selection Procedure
1. Stage I – INET (Computer Based Test)
Online exam with 100 questions covering English, Science, Maths and General Awareness. Duration is 1 hour with negative marking of 0.25 for each wrong answers.
2. Shortlisting
Candidates will be shortlisted state-wise based on INET marks/scores. Cut-off varies by state by state.
3. Stage II Process
Includes Physical Fitness Test, Written Examination and Medical Examination.
4. Physical Fitness Test (PFT)
Male: 1.6 Km run in 6 min 30 sec, 20 squats, 15 push-ups, 15 sit-ups
Female: 1.6 Km run in 8 min, 15 squats, 10 sit-ups
5. Stage II Written Exam
Will be conducted for 100 questions, for 1 hour duration, same subjects as Stage I.
6. Medical Examination
Conducted by military doctors including height (157 cm), vision test, physical and mental fitness test.
7. Final Merit List
Based on Stage II performance and medical fitness final merit list will be published.
